Kim is the creative mind behind Nordys most recent French themed pop-in shop that debuted on the metro level of the downtown store on Thursday, October 10th. The first of a series to premiere at a select group of eight brick and mortar stores nationwide, including our flagship location.

Inspired by her most recent trip to Paris Fashion Week in March and her French bulldog – the event mascot splayed throughout the collection – Kim curated a-my-favorite-things type mash-up of limited edition items by exclusive Parisian and American brands for the French Fling pop-up. Expect street-wear essentials, fashionable reads and other charming novelties in the high-low range. Including cool-kid crewnecks, tees and fitted caps by the likes of APC, Rodarte and Kenzo, characteristic clutches by accessories genius Olympia Le-Tan, Chanel goods (of course) and more. Our favorite: a cozy cotton pullover with nautical navy stripes by sailing aficionados Saint James, also bearing the now iconic, custom embroidered bulldog, which Kim coyly smiles and points at while introducing me to the boat-wear line, “that’s my baby”. The pop-in also marks the state-side premiere of the charming Paris-based home goods company, Merci.
